美文网首页PHP程序员
MySQL TIMESTAMP设置默认时间

MySQL TIMESTAMP设置默认时间

作者: php转go | 来源:发表于2021-01-14 12:06 被阅读0次

数据表字段默认值

  `create_time` timestamp NULL DEFAULT CURRENT_TIMESTAMP,

设置create_time默认值,新增记录时,直接录入当前时间,不需要额外做date("Y-m-d H:i:s")处理

  `updateTime` timestamp null ON UPDATE CURRENT_TIMESTAMP,

设置updateTime的类型为timestamp时间戳类型,设置ON UPDATE CURRENT_TIMESTAMP,记录发生变化时也要更新该时间戳。

有些文档说要设置默认值为DEFAULT CURRENT_TIMESTAMP才有效,其实并不需要

相关文章

网友评论

    本文标题:MySQL TIMESTAMP设置默认时间

    本文链接:https://www.haomeiwen.com/subject/qjfvaktx.html